Year 7 Robotics

Year 7 Robotics is an elective class that offers students a hands on opportunity to explore robots and automation. They plan, design, build and program spike prime robots. These students built a t-shirt folding robot and a basketball hoop n' shooter robot.

Supporting Your Child Through NAPLAN - Important Dates and Tips

Official test dates are 12-17 March, with catch-up sessions from 18-20 March.

To help reduce stress and anxiety, here are some tips to support your child:

  • Encourage a Calm Mindset: Remind them that NAPLAN is just a snapshot of their learning, not a reflection of their future success.
  • Arrive on Time: Ensure your child arrives on time each day to avoid feeling rushed or stressed.

Additional Tips to Prepare:

  • Get Enough Sleep: Ensure your child rests well to stay focused and perform well.
  • Eat a Balanced Diet: Nutritious meals support both brain and body, especially on test days.
  • Stay Hydrated: Bring a water bottle to stay focused throughout the day.
  • Reassure Your Child: Remind them that NAPLAN is just one way to assess learning and does not define their future.

By working together and keeping the environment supportive, we can help our children approach NAPLAN with confidence and calmness.

Fit2Drive Incursion

This half-day workshop aimed to enhance students' understanding of road safety, decision-making, and risk assessment as young road users. With the expertise of Victoria Police and Fire Rescue Victoria officers, students explored key road laws and engaged in discussions around a real-life case study.

Year 7 Camp - The Summit

Students travelled to The Summit for their Year 7 Camp, where they focused on building confidence, resilience, teamwork, and personal growth. We are extremely proud of those who pushed themselves and embraced the adventure. They took part in exciting activities like the Sky Bridge, Giant Swing, Mud Race, Flying Fox, and even abseiled down the Big Tower!
